The Middle East in Modern World History examines how global trends
over the last 200 years have shaped the Middle East and how these
trends were affected by the region's development. Covering a key
period in the history of the Middle East, this book highlights
three major trends within the region's development over the past
two centuries: the role of the region as a strategic conduit
between East and West, the development of the region's natural
resources, especially oil, and the impact of a rapidly globalizing
world economy on the Middle East. This new edition extends coverage
to the present day and includes more thematic and interpretive
discussion on the impact of global migration and the evolution of
the roles of women. It also provides more theoretical insights into
current historical research and recent developments in the region,
firmly placing these developments within their historical context.
Clearly written and supported throughout by maps, images,
discussion questions, and suggestions for further reading, as well
as including a comprehensive chronology and glossary that enable
readers to develop a clearer picture of political, economic,
social, and cultural life within the region, The Middle East in
Modern World History is the perfect textbook for all students of
the history of the modern Middle East within a global context.
